when i turn the ignition key and all the lighty things come on, the fuel gauge works, but when i go to start the engine, the fuel gauge goes to zero untill the engine has started- ti dont happen to anything else, is it an earthing problem? if so can someone tell me where the earth points are, so i can clean them up i have def td5 2002,

It's on a R designated circuit, via an ignition load relay which means it only gets power at I and II or possibly only II, only circuits designated 15 get power on II and III.

Things like heaters, lights and radios tend to get put onto R circuits to either reduce load, or protect electronic equipment that may not like the voltage drop/surge.
